Landmark Health is a high growth, entrepreneurial, home-based provider team that is transforming healthcare by serving the extensive needs of the most chronically ill in our communities. Physicians lead a multidisciplinary team and serve on the frontlines delivering preventive and urgent medical care in the homes of complex, frail, and vulnerable patients.

Through the integration of technology, a highly innovative care delivery model, and multidisciplinary clinical teams, Landmark delivers health management capabilities at scale for the frailest and most clinically complex segments of the population – the 3-5% of members that account for 20-30% of all national healthcare expenses annually.

Responsibilities

As a Physician, your duties will be to:

  • Function as day-to-day clinical leader, providing decision support to nurse practitioners and directing the multidisciplinary team
  • Perform 4-6 preventive visits daily to optimize chronic conditions, assess home environment, educate patients and caregivers, and develop proactive care plans
  • Perform urgent care visits in the home to avoid unnecessary ED transfers and hospital admissions
  • Leverage the support of nurse care manager, behavioral health, social work, pharmacy, and dietician to meet patients’ medical, biopsychosocial, and financial needs
  • In situations where there is no existing PCP for the patient, assume responsibility as PCP to drive care and continuity for patients
  • In situations where there is an existing PCP for the patient, help to co-manage the patient with the PCP and serve as an extension of clinical care into the home
  • Coordinate with other physicians across the continuum of care, including PCP, hospitalist, and SNF providers to smooth transitions and prevent readmissions
  • Coordinate and offer medical direction to community-based organizations touching the lives of our patients, including housing and caregiver agencies, health plan contracted social work services, home health, adult day health centers, and behavioral health
